Affected Systems
ServiceNow AI Platform versions: Xanadu (before Patch 11 HF 7a), Yokohama (before Patch 12 HF 3b / Patch 13 HF 4), Zurich (before Patch 7b HF 3 through Patch 12 depending on branch), Australia (before Patch 2 HF 3 through Patch 5). Four CVEs: CVE-2026-18885 (code injection via GraphQL), CVE-2026-18886 (access control bypass in image upload), CVE-2026-74820 (SQL injection via ORDER BY), CVE-2026-6876 (sandbox escape, CVSS 8.7). Affects self-hosted and partner-hosted instances requiring manual patching.
Exploitation Status
No active exploitation observed as of August 28, 2026. No public PoC code available for the three CVSS 10.0 flaws. ServiceNow-hosted instances already patched. Related vulnerability CVE-2026-6875 (July 2026) saw suspected exploitation that turned out to be researcher PoC activity.
Business Impact
Critical risk for self-hosted and partner-hosted ServiceNow AI Platform deployments. All three maximum-severity flaws are remotely exploitable without authentication or user interaction, allowing arbitrary code execution, privilege escalation, database manipulation, and access to sensitive instance data. Attack complexity rated low. ServiceNow-hosted customers already protected; self-hosted organizations must patch immediately. No CISA KEV listing yet, but CVSS 10.0 rating reflects complete system compromise potential.

Recommended Actions
- Immediately identify all self-hosted and partner-hosted ServiceNow AI Platform instances in your environment and verify their patch levels against the advisory
- Apply vendor patches per ServiceNow's August 27, 2026 advisory: Xanadu Patch 11 HF 7a or later, Yokohama Patch 12 HF 3b / Patch 13 HF 4 or later, Zurich Patch 10 HF 3 / Patch 12 or later (depending on branch), Australia Patch 5 or later
- Monitor ServiceNow instance logs for anomalous GraphQL API requests, unauthorized image uploads to system configuration endpoints, unusual SQL query patterns in ORDER BY clauses, and sandbox escape attempts
- If immediate patching is not feasible, implement network segmentation to restrict unauthenticated access to ServiceNow AI Platform instances and require VPN or IP allowlisting
- Review ServiceNow instance access logs from the past 90 days for indicators of compromise, focusing on unauthenticated API calls and privilege escalation events
